I loved some of the pieces, but not all of them worked for me. Overall, for me, this collection was both a hit and a miss. I loved how the two pieces went together for each poem and story as it gave a new level to my reading experience. This is one reason I highly recommend the print over the audio, unless you do both, as you miss the drawings in the audio version. Along with the writing are illustrations done by the author that accompanies each piece which was gorgeous. There are princesses rescuing themselves, villains who are comfortable being villains, new perspectives on certain stories, and many other unique twists. There is a large mix of poems and stories, so there is bound to be something that every reader will enjoy. Fierce Fairytales is a collection of familiar stories with a new look whether it be a twist on good and evil or a feminist look on the idea of the damsel (or princess) in distress.
